Ryan Ferguson's evidentiary hearing came to a close Friday morning, leaving Cole County Circuit Judge Daniel Green to decide by mid-June whether he will overrule Ferguson's 2005 conviction.

In their closing arguments, attorneys presented opposing interpretations of the way Green should consider recanted testimonies from Jerry Trump and Charles "Chuck" Erickson as he makes his decision. If Green rules in favor of Ferguson, Ferguson could be provided an opportunity for a new trial, contingent upon appeals made after Green's ruling.

Ferguson's co-defendant, Chuck Erickson, recanted his testimony at an evidentiary hearing in April. The court did not find Erickson's recantation to be credible.

The ruling also states that the recantation of witness Jerry Trump did not undermine the court's confidence in the original jury's verdict.
